Resaltado de las filas de las celdas seleccionadas (Microsoft Excel)
A veces es fácil perder de vista dónde se encuentra la celda seleccionada en una hoja de trabajo. Hay varias formas de ubicar la celda, pero a veces sería útil tener una forma de resaltar toda la fila de la celda seleccionada.
La forma más sencilla de hacer esto en Excel es presionar Mayús + Barra espaciadora. Se resalta toda la fila y la celda seleccionada permanece igual. Si desea moverse a otra celda en la misma fila (sin cambiar el resaltado), puede usar Tab para moverse hacia la derecha y Shift + Tab para moverse hacia la izquierda.
Si prefiere que Excel resalte automáticamente la fila, debe confiar en una macro. El siguiente hará el truco:
Sub Worksheet_SelectionChange(ByVal Target As Excel.Range) Static rr Static cc If cc <> "" Then With Columns(cc).Interior .ColorIndex = xlNone End With With Rows(rr).Interior .ColorIndex = xlNone End With End If r = Selection.Row c = Selection.Column rr = r cc = c With Columns(c).Interior .ColorIndex = 20 .Pattern = xlSolid End With With Rows(r).Interior .ColorIndex = 20 .Pattern = xlSolid End With End Sub
Asegúrese de adjuntar la macro a la hoja de trabajo que está utilizando en ese momento. Todo lo que hace el código es resaltar la fila y la columna en la que se encuentra la celda activa. Al moverse a otra celda, el código recuerda la celda anterior (mediante el uso de variables declaradas como estáticas) y elimina el resaltado de las filas y columnas anteriores. Este código resalta tanto la fila como la columna actual. Para simplemente resaltar la fila, elimine los fragmentos de código con r y rr en ellos. El único problema real con este método es que si su hoja tiene celdas anteriores llenas de color, estas se cambiarán a NoFill, borrando cualquier color que estuviera allí.
_Nota: _
Si desea saber cómo usar las macros descritas en esta página (o en cualquier otra página de los sitios ExcelTips), he preparado una página especial que incluye información útil.
link: / excelribbon-ExcelTipsMacros [Haga clic aquí para abrir esa página especial en una nueva pestaña del navegador]
.
ExcelTips es su fuente de formación rentable en Microsoft Excel.
Este consejo (2457) se aplica a Microsoft Excel 97, 2000, 2002 y 2003. Puede encontrar una versión de este consejo para la interfaz de cinta de Excel (Excel 2007 y posterior) aquí:
link: / excelribbon-Highlighting_the_Rows_of_Selected_Cells [Resaltando las filas de las celdas seleccionadas]
.